How To Fix MPLAN578 - Maintenance Plan number is initial


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: MPLAN - Messages for Maintenance Plan API

  • Message number: 578

  • Message text: Maintenance Plan number is initial

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message MPLAN578 - Maintenance Plan number is initial ?

    The SAP error message MPLAN578 indicates that the maintenance plan number is initial, meaning that the system is expecting a valid maintenance plan number but has received an empty or null value instead. This error typically occurs when trying to create or process a maintenance plan without specifying a valid identifier.

    Cause:

    1. Missing Maintenance Plan Number: The most common cause is that the maintenance plan number field is left blank or not properly populated in the transaction or program you are using.
    2. Incorrect Configuration: There may be issues with the configuration of the maintenance plan or the related master data.
    3. User Input Error: The user may have inadvertently skipped entering the maintenance plan number or made a typographical error.

    Solution:

    1. Check Input Fields: Ensure that you are entering a valid maintenance plan number in the relevant field. If you are creating a new maintenance plan, make sure to fill in all required fields.
    2. Create a Maintenance Plan: If you are trying to reference a maintenance plan that does not exist, you will need to create it first. Use the transaction code IP01 (Create Maintenance Plan) to create a new maintenance plan.
    3. Review Configuration: If you are working with a custom program or transaction, check the underlying code or configuration to ensure that it correctly retrieves and passes the maintenance plan number.
    4. Consult Documentation: Refer to SAP documentation or help files for guidance on the specific transaction or process you are working with to ensure all necessary steps are followed.
    5. Check Authorizations: Ensure that you have the necessary authorizations to access and create maintenance plans in the system.

    Related Information:

    • Transaction Codes: Common transaction codes related to maintenance plans include:
      • IP01: Create Maintenance Plan
      • IP02: Change Maintenance Plan
      • IP03: Display Maintenance Plan
